lib/kcl/state.ex
defmodule Kcl.State do
@moduledoc """
On-going KCl session state
Some helpers to maintain state between messages
"""
defstruct our_private: nil,
our_public: nil,
their_public: nil,
shared_secret: nil,
previous_nonce: 0
@type t :: %__MODULE__{}
@doc """
Initialize a new state
The private key will be used to derive the public one, if such is
not supplied. There is, otherwise, no verification that the supplied
keys form a valid pair.
"""
@spec init(Kcl.key(), Kcl.key() | nil) :: Kcl.State.t()
def init(our_private, our_public \\ nil) do
our_public =
case our_public do
nil -> Kcl.derive_public_key(our_private)
_ -> our_public
end
%Kcl.State{our_private: our_private, our_public: our_public}
end
@doc """
update the state for a new peer
The shared secret is computed from the state and new peer public key.
The previous_nonce value is also reset to `0`.
"""
@spec new_peer(Kcl.State.t(), Kcl.key()) :: Kcl.State.t() | :error
def new_peer(state, their_public) do
case Kcl.shared_secret(state.our_private, their_public) do
:error ->
:error
ss ->
struct(state,
their_public: their_public,
shared_secret: ss,
# Just in case someone reuses the struct.
previous_nonce: 0
)
end
end
end
